Microdrip Infusion Set
A medical apparatus designed for the administration of fluids and medications into patients, delivering small, precisely controlled drops per milliliter (usually 60 drops/ml).
Estimated Flow Rate
An approximation of the speed at which fluids are administered intravenously, often calculated to ensure proper medication dosing.
Tubing Factor Information
Details relevant to the calibration or characteristics of tubing used, especially in medical devices for fluid delivery.
Microdrip
A type of drip set for an intravenous infusion that delivers a small amount of fluid, typically 60 drops per ml, used for precise fluid delivery.
